Abstract:

Regarding the remarkable increase in multilingualism expansion and research, this study aimed to focus on the case of Iranian multilingual learners in terms of the cognitively default language used for word choice in L۴ writing task when the instruction is in L۱. This study also tried to account the issues via the theories notified by the Parasitic Model (PM). The main concentration in this research was on learners’ L۴ writing analysis through considerations on the learners’ diaries and reports on semi-structured interviews. The results showed that the cases under investigation utilized various strategies both in isolation and in combination with other strategies which could also provide justifications for the operationalization of PM in word choice in L۴ writing tasks. The findings of this study might be beneficial for the development of successful multilingual learners in addition, teachers, curriculum designers, teacher training designers, and materials developers may benefit from the results of this study to teach multilingual learners in a more efficient way. Another implication of this study might be a call for more consideration about the increasing multilingual learners for both pedagogical and research purposes.
